Student registration for Rochester public
schools is open daily (except holidays). The registration location
is determined by the student’s grade level. In order to
complete registration, the student’s parent or legal guardian
MUST bring:
|
| • a copy of the child’s birth certificate |
| • immunization records |
| • proof of residency |
|
Items
Accepted to Prove Residency |
- Copy of a fully executed lease, with the
name and phone number of the landlord
- Copy of a fully executed closing statement
- Telephone, electric, and cable bills
- Envelopes with yellow forwarding postal
sticker
- Billing or mailing address from current
doctor's bill, bank statement, or payroll check
|
Items
NOT accepted to Prove Residency |
-
Property tax bill
-
Water/sewer bill
- Voter registration
- Vehicle registration
- Driver's license
- Post Office Box
|
|
All Elementary registrations (grades K-5)
are taken at the office of the Superintendent of Schools ~ located
at 150 Wakefield Street, Suite 8 (Rochester Community Center
~ second floor) ~ 8:00 AM until 4:00 PM Monday through Friday.
Middle School registrations (grades 6-8) are taken
in the Guidance Office at the Rochester Middle School ~ located
at 47 Brock Street ~ 7:30 AM until 2:30 PM Monday through
Friday.
High School registrations (grades 9-12) are taken
at Spaulding High School ~ located at 130 Wakefield Street
~ 7:30 AM until 2:30 PM Monday through Friday.
